This is my home DZ and I wouldn't jump anywhere else. Premier is great. We are growing, and that rocks!
Our DZO, Bill, is awesome, as is the girl, Amy, that runs manifest.
Our pilots rock. This is just a great place to skydive. New gear that is well maintained, a great vibe, etc. We have inside showers, a great place to camp within 1/4 of a mile, inside padded packing, awesome video (dvd) and still editing equipment. We are not far from Lake Michigan, and the view is amazing from altitude. There are also a ton of local lakes and woods. In the fall the color tour from altitude is worth just riding the plane up and down.
Skydiving is a bonus.
Bill and Amy run a great DZ.
Everyone is always welcome no matter where they have jumped before or their level of experience.

I made my first sky dive here, and due to babysitter reasons, I had to continue my training else where, however this year the other dz closed, and Premier welcomed me back with open arms, making sure I was totally comfortable with their state of the art student gear before the jump. The staff is wonderful welcoming every new face that walks in. Fun jumpers get to go, students get to go. It's a great place. I can't see myself going any where else!

New student gear, new tandem gear. experienced, uspa rated instructors. no shortcuts taken in student instruction.
45 minutes north of Grand Rapids.
A student oriented dropzone that makes sure fun jumpers get on loads.
